Morning.....Afternoon All,

 

Been asked to look into a site management system, where we can store info about a certain site and contents and pictures there of. E.g. Cab 1, has server 1 , server 2, ups 1 etc. and pictures of all. Needs to integrate with 365.

 

Anyone know of any decent systems?

 

Thanks

SharePoint list spring to mind. That would allow to you structure your data quite a bit so as to be able to include serial numbers and other asset details. There's almost certainly an asset register template that you could start it up with.

Managed Service desk surely? All the assets should be in there already, along with their locations. Ours doesn't have a place for photos, or drawings specifically, but if it were a requirement to have the assets/drawings/photos all in one place, I would open ticket against each asset and attach the photo to the ticket. Ticket title would be ASSET NUMBER - photo / Asset Number - Cabinet Drawing etc to make it easy to spot in the asset's ticket history.

 

In actual fact what we do is have a spreadsheet for the site infrastructure assets that is reviewable and consumable by SLT and Auditors. This sheet has links out to the appropriate additional information such as the asset record in the service desk, the folder of hardware documentation, the folder of service vendor documentation etc etc.
